Porotech Taps GaN-on-silicon Micro-LED Foundry Partner
Micro-LED technology developer Porotech has partnered with Taiwan’s Powerchip Semiconductor Manufacturing Corp. (PSMC) for the mass production of micro-LEDs on 200-mm gallium nitride (GaN)-on-silicon for consumer display applications. The partnership comes after Porotech
partnered with Foxconn to accelerate its research and production of micro-LED technology last month.
Porotech’s "PoroGaN" microdisplay platform enables full-color or tunable color displays using identical pixels from a single wafer to achieve color uniformity while eliminating complex fabrication processes. The company
unveiled its Dynamic Pixel Tuning technology during 2022’s Display Week. The technology has earned Porotech a
nomination for a 2024 Prism Award in the AR/VR/MR category.
